要优化WordPress数据库以提高性能与安全性,您应定期备份数据库,并使用工具如 WP-Optimize、WP-Sweep 或 dbOptimizer 执行清理和优化,限制插件数量和安装新插件,并确保它们为最新版本,安装安全插件,如 Wordfence 或 Sucuri,以保护您的网站免受恶意攻击,编辑 wp-config.php 文件并添加数据库主机、用户名、密码等信息以确保正确连接,定期审查和更新您的主题和插件以确保最佳兼容性和安全性。
在数字时代,网站的重要性日益凸显,而WordPress作为世界上最受欢迎的网站建设和管理平台之一,其性能和安全性问题也受到了广泛的关注,优化WordPress数据库不仅能够提升网站的运行速度,还能够为网站提供更可靠的安全保障,本文将深入探讨如何有效地优化WordPress数据库,以提升网站的整体性能和安全性。
定期备份数据库
为了防止数据丢失,我们应该养成定期备份数据库的习惯,可以使用插件如UpdraftPlus或Duplicator来实现自动备份,确保在遭遇任何问题时都能迅速恢复到之前的状态。
优化表结构
合理的数据库表结构对于优化WordPress数据库至关重要,删除不必要的字段和表格,合并重复的表,并调整主从表的设置以减少数据冗余,可以有效提升数据库的性能。
合理配置MySQL
通过调整MySQL的配置文件(如my.cnf),可以优化数据库的性能,增加内存分配,调整缓存设置,启用查询缓存等,都能显著提高数据库的处理速度。
使用缓存插件
安装并配置缓存插件,如W3 Total Cache或WP Super Cache,可以将动态内容缓存到静态HTML文件,减少数据库查询次数,从而提升网站响应速度。
优化SQL查询
优化SQL查询是提升数据库性能的关键步骤,避免使用SELECT *,而是只选择需要的字段;减少JOIN操作;使用EXPLAIN分析查询计划,找出并优化慢查询等。
禁用不必要的插件和功能
检查并禁用那些不再使用的或不必要的WordPress插件和功能,减少数据库的负担。
数据表的优化
定期进行数据表优化可以消除潜在的性能问题,可以使用MySQL的OPTIMIZE TABLE命令来整理表空间。
使用InnoDB存储引擎
默认情况下,WordPress使用MyISAM存储引擎,但在处理大量数据和事务时,建议切换到InnoDB存储引擎,因为它提供了更好的事务支持和行级锁定。
优化WordPress数据库是一项复杂但至关重要的任务,通过实施上述策略,不仅可以显著提升网站的性能,还能够增强网站的安全性,建议网站管理员定期进行数据库优化,并密切关注网站运行状态的变化,以便及时发现并解决问题,通过持续的努力和改进,您的WordPress网站将变得更加高效、稳定和安全。


还没有评论,来说两句吧...